Solution for 16t^2+100t=0 equation:


Simplifying
16t2 + 100t = 0

Reorder the terms:
100t + 16t2 = 0

Solving
100t + 16t2 = 0

Solving for variable 't'.

Factor out the Greatest Common Factor (GCF), '4t'.
4t(25 + 4t) = 0

Ignore the factor 4.

Subproblem 1

Set the factor 't' equal to zero and attempt to solve: Simplifying t = 0 Solving t = 0 Move all terms containing t to the left, all other terms to the right. Simplifying t = 0

Subproblem 2

Set the factor '(25 + 4t)' equal to zero and attempt to solve: Simplifying 25 + 4t = 0 Solving 25 + 4t = 0 Move all terms containing t to the left, all other terms to the right. Add '-25' to each side of the equation. 25 + -25 + 4t = 0 + -25 Combine like terms: 25 + -25 = 0 0 + 4t = 0 + -25 4t = 0 + -25 Combine like terms: 0 + -25 = -25 4t = -25 Divide each side by '4'. t = -6.25 Simplifying t = -6.25

Solution

t = {0, -6.25}
